Who Will Win In This Head-To-Head?
In today’s match between Harriet Dart from Great Britain and Xinyu Wang from China, Dart leads the head-to-head record 1-0. Dart previously defeated Wang in the qualifying round at the Melbourne tournament in January 2022. Dart is aiming to reach the second week of a Grand Slam for the first time in her career, with her previous best performance being reaching the third round at Wimbledon in 2019 where she lost to world No.1 Ash Barty. Dart is one of three British women who have advanced to the third round at Wimbledon, and the last time this happened was in 1984. On the other hand, Wang achieved her first Top 10 win by defeating Jessica Pegula, who was ranked No.5 and the recent champion in Berlin, in the second round at Wimbledon. Wang is also looking to match her career-best Grand Slam result with a win in this match, which was reaching the Round of 16 at the 2023 US Open. Wang is one of two Chinese women to reach the third round at Wimbledon in this tournament. The best performance by a Chinese player at Wimbledon was a semifinal run by Jie Zheng in 2008.
Regarding Harriet Dart’s tournament history, this is her sixth appearance in the main draw at Wimbledon, and she has equalled her best result by reaching the third round. She also reached the third round in 2019, losing to world No.1 Ash Barty. Dart has defeated Zhuoxuan Bai and her compatriot Katie Boulter in a third-set match tiebreak to reach the third round this year. She has a record of 5-3 on grass this season, including a quarterfinal appearance at Eastbourne and a second-round performance at Birmingham. In the third round, she will face Xinyu Wang, and Dart has 11 career wins over Top 50 players, with her most recent victory being against No.29 Boulter in the previous round. Among the British players, Dart is one of three who have reached the third round at Wimbledon, alongside Kartal and Raducanu. The most recent British Wimbledon champion in ladies’ singles is Virginia Wade in 1977. The last time three British players reached the third round at Wimbledon was in 1984, with Hobbs, Salmon, Durie, Croft, and Wade. Dart is currently ranked No.100, with her career-high ranking being No.84 in 2022, and at this time last year, she was ranked No.135.
As for Xinyu Wang’s tournament history, this is her third appearance in the main draw at Wimbledon, and she has achieved her best result so far by reaching the third round. Previously, she reached the second round in 2023, losing to Kenin. Wang has defeated Viktoriya Tomova and No.5 Jessica Pegula in the first two rounds of this year’s Wimbledon. Her victory over Pegula in the second round marked her first win over a Top 10 player in her career. In the third round, she will face Harriet Dart, and Wang is aiming to match her best Grand Slam result by reaching the Round of 16, which she achieved at the 2023 US Open. Wang has a perfect 2-0 career record against players from the United Kingdom, although her record against them in 2024 is 0-0. Her best career result on grass was reaching the Round of 16 in Berlin in 2022. Among the Chinese players, Wang is one of two who have reached the third round at Wimbledon, along with Zhu Lin. The best result by a Chinese woman at Wimbledon was a semifinalist run by Jie Zheng in 2008. The last time two Chinese players reached the third round at Wimbledon was in 2022, with Zheng Qinwen and Zhang Shuai. Wang is currently ranked No.42, and at this time last year, she was ranked No.73. In 2024, she has won 17 main draw matches at the Tour level, including her two wins at Wimbledon. Wang has been involved in 15 three-set matches in 2024.}
